How we build it here
Vinyl only performs when it's engineered right, so every Morton install uses heavy-wall posts, aluminum-reinforced bottom rails on wide spans, and 42-inch concrete-set footings. Deep prairie loam over clay — clean digging, but posts still need to reach the 42-inch frost line. We use routed-post systems so panels lock in rather than screw on, and we size gate posts up so the swing stays square in July heat and January cold.
Vinyl typically installs in one to two days, though posts often cure overnight before panels go in.

Vinyl Fence questions from Morton homeowners.
- What does vinyl fence cost in Morton, IL?
- Installed vinyl in Morton generally runs $38–$65 per linear foot — about $5,700–$9,750 for a typical 150-ft backyard. It costs more up front than wood and less over 20 years, because there's no staining, no warping, and no board replacement.
- Will vinyl fence crack in Central Illinois winters?
- Quality vinyl won't. Cheap thin-wall vinyl will. We install impact-modified panels rated for cold-weather brittleness, which is exactly the spec that matters in Tazewell County. The other half of the equation is post depth — a panel cracks when the post heaves and torques it, so our 42-inch footings do most of the protecting.
- Do vinyl fences meet Morton HOA requirements?
- Morton requires a village fence permit and a plat of survey for most residential fences; we pull it as part of the job. Most HOAs in this area approve vinyl in white, almond, and clay, with a height cap of 6 ft in rear yards and 4 ft in front. We'll pull the spec sheet and color chip you need for the architectural review packet.
- Can vinyl follow the slope of my Morton lot?
- Mostly flat to gently rolling lots, with a few walkout basements on the north side that need a stepped or racked run. Vinyl panels rack a limited amount, so on steeper grade we step the panels and close the triangle gap at the bottom with a raked kickboard. We'll show you both options on-site before ordering material.
